Animal Breeding and Genetics

Animal breeding and genetics is the science of selecting and mating animals to produce specific traits in their offspring. By understanding genetics—the study of heredity and variation—breeders can enhance desirable characteristics such as size, appearance, behavior, and health in animals like dogs, cattle, and horses. This process often involves controlled breeding practices and knowledge of genetic principles, ensuring that traits are passed down effectively. Advances in genetics, including technology like DNA testing, further improve breeders' ability to make informed decisions and promote the welfare of the animals while meeting agricultural and companionship needs.
